Output 5c317827706051d578792785eebcd4ec53534d75cc9e310a5da13a4bbf0cafde:7

value
367350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e4e1182c62cc29bd33cdc3ced7867e125bab36b OP_EQUAL
address
3BkFmw41KDSqcqRmJxMbYnFgq2itaEsgHE
transaction
5c317827706051d578792785eebcd4ec53534d75cc9e310a5da13a4bbf0cafde
spent
true